Teach students how to create inclusive conversations and use consensus so all will feel validated & valued. Typically, when students engage in brainstorming, there are 1 or 2 students who do most of the talking, 1 who maybe gives an idea or two, and 1 person who is completely disengaged. These directions on creating an inclusive discussion will ensure that ALL students are participating. The leaders of the group will no longer dominate the conversations. Teaching style

My teaching style is to use hands on activities, inquiry, technology, and to infuse SEL throughout various seemingly unrelated courses. I explicitly teach the skills needed for students to have rich small group discussions, effective research techniques, and offer choice as to how students present their learning.
